1 Samuel 25:44
1 Samuel 25:44 — English Standard Version (ESV)
44 Saul had given Michal his daughter, David’s wife, to Palti the son of Laish, who was of Gallim.
1 Samuel 25:44 — King James Version (KJV 1900)
44 But Saul had given Michal his daughter, David’s wife, to Phalti the son of Laish, which was of Gallim.
